Hi guys, thought I'd share some constructive feedback. I love Adobe Spark! But ever since you changed the New project page, I find it far less useful and more difficult to use. The previous setup allowed you to search far more pre-existing templates (by scrolling sideways along the carousel) which were categorized by theme - i.e. business, seasonal (very useful!), travel, collages etc.). Now the templates are categorized by purpose (grow your business, teach and study etc.), and there's far fewer of them to gain inspiration from.
Also, the search function doesn't really serve the function you would expect. It appears only to be for finding a style of template (Insta post, Facebook video etc.), rather than a theme of post. For example, a user may wish to search for a "sale event graphic" for their business, then select a pre-existing template to edit... however instead I'm presented with a choice between 'brochure' or 'Etsy banner' etc.. which is not what I'm looking for. The wide range of pre-designed graphics is what made Spark a great go-to resource for novice designers and marketers. Resizing for a particular was only ever a click away, so it wasn't necessary to make the platform the top level select.
I still love Spark, but I don't think you quite nailed the new project facility with this update. Hope that makes sense. Thank you for the wonderful work you do.
